HEAT-SEALABLE BIODEGRADABLE PACKAGING MATERIAL, ITS MANUFACTURING METHOD AND A PRODUT PACKAGE MADE THEREFROM AND A PRODUCT PACKAGE MADE THEREFROM

The invention relates to a heat-sealable biodegradable packaging material, which comprises a fiber substrate 1 as well as one or more polymeric coating layers extruded thereon. According to the invention, the material includes a polymeric coating layer 2, which contains not less than 90 weight-% of polylactide and, as an additive, not more than 10 weight-% of acrylic copolymer blended therein for improving the adhesion and/or heat sealing ability of the layer. The invention encompasses also a method for manufacturing packaging material, as well as a product package obtained from the material.
